  1. What is the National Health Policy of Pakistan?

    The vision of the National Health Vision 2025 is to improve the health of all Pakistanis, especially women, and children, by ensuring universal access and financial security to quality essential health services, focusing on vulnerable groups, and providing flexible and responsive care through the health system.

  3. How many levels are there in Pakistan’s health system?

    According to the constitution of Pakistan, health provision is the responsibility of the provincial governments, except in federally administered areas. The delivery of state health care services is being managed through a three-tier health care delivery system.
